LYF Water 11 sports a 5-inch HD display, 3GB RAM and VoLTE, yours for Rs 8,199

“The Water 11 offers a 1.3GHz quad-core SoC, 16GB of storage, 13MP/5MP cameras and Marshmallow”

Reliance Retail has added a new member to its LYF range with the launch of the Water 11. It comes as a successor to the LYF Water 10, which was launched last week. The phone has been listed on the company’s website for Rs 8,199, and is expected to go on sale via brick-and-mortar retail stores like Reliance Digital and Digital Express in the coming days.



LYF Water 11

The LYF Water 11 sports a 5-inch HD IPS display bearing a pixel density of 294ppi. It utilises a 1.3GHz quad-core 64-bit MediaTek 6735A processor, mated to 3GB of RAM and a Mali T720-MP2 GPU. The phone offers 16GB of internal memory, further expandable up to 32GB with the help of a microSD card. Camera features include a 13-meg autofocus rear snapper with 1080p video recording, and a 5-meg front shooter.

In terms of connectivity, the Water 11 offers 4G with VoLTE, dual-SIM slots,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th 4.1, USB OTG and GPS. It is fuelled by a 2,100mAh battery, which offers up to seven hours of talk time. Software-wise, it runs Android 6.0 Marshmallow out-of-the-box, and comes with gesture controls.

Similar to other LYF-branded smartphones, the Water 11 also comes bundled with a Reliance Jio SIM. Following the company’s announcement on Thursday, it will also fall under the Jio Welcome Offer that includes unlimited data, calling, SMS, and access to premium content till December 31st.
